Asphalt shingles repurposed to be used on a new Chicago O'Hare International Airport runway
The culture of sustainable progress fostered at Caterpillar is extended through the sustainable efforts of our Cat® Customers.
Plote Construction was recently featured in a video by the Chicago Tribune operating Cat® equipment to use 10,000 tons of material originating from old asphalt shingles to build a 7,500 foot runway in the Chicago O'Hare International Airport. Plote Construction, a customer of Patten Cat, is a heavy-highway contractor operating in the Chicago area.
